Thanks guys. last question regarding the bypass cable. I have one for my Superchip flashcal that looks like the one in the above thread. Since it plugs into the same connectors would it function the same or is the alpha odb program specific?
It may work. The bypass cable isn't Alfa specific. It just makes the tool capable of communicating with the BCM. If you already have an adapter that looks similar you may not need to buy another one. Give it a try and see. If it's wrong you will know right away because you won't be able to connect to your truck.
